Commercial site clearing services involve the removal of vegetation, debris, and obstructions from large parcels of land to prepare them for development or use. These services typically include the removal of trees, shrubs, stumps, and underbrush, as well as the clearing of rocks, old structures, and other debris that may hinder construction or landscaping efforts. Heavy equipment such as bulldozers, excavators, and grinders are often utilized to ensure the land is level, accessible, and ready for the next phase of development. The goal is to create a clean, safe, and functional site that meets the specific requirements of commercial projects.

These services help address common problems associated with undeveloped or overgrown land, such as obstructed access, safety hazards, and unsuitable terrain for construction. Overgrown vegetation can impede the movement of construction equipment and pose fire risks, while debris or old structures may obstruct utility installation or building foundations. Clearing also helps to identify any underlying issues with the land, such as uneven surfaces or hidden obstructions, allowing project planners to move forward efficiently and safely. Proper site clearing is a critical step in minimizing delays and avoiding unforeseen complications during development.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Site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Costa Mesa,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Acre Costs - Commercial site clearing typ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000 per acre, depending on the density of vegetation and site size. For example, clearing a half-acre lot may cost around $750 to $2,500. Costs can vary based on the complexity of the terrain and required equipment.

Per Square Foot Pricing - Some contractors charge between $0.10 and $0.50 per square foot for site clearing services. For a 10,000-square-foot lot, this could translate to $1,000 to $5,000. The specific price depends on vegetation type and accessibility.

Type of Vegetation - Clearing costs differ based on vegetation type, with brush and small trees costing approximately $500 to $2,000 per acre. Removing large trees or stumps can increase costs significantly, sometimes exceeding $3,000 per tree. The density of plant growth influences overall expenses.

Additional Service Fees - Extra services such as debris removal or grading may add $500 to $2,500 to the total cost. For example, hauling away debris from a commercial lot can increase the overall expense depending on volume. Contractors often provide estimates based on specific site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
